WebSep 19, 2024 · Can injured kidneys heal? If the injury was minor, it can take up to two weeks for a bruised kidney to heal on its own. Even with mild symptoms, kidney injuries can progress into serious complications and may cause internal bleeding. If you were in an accident that injured your back or abdomen, call your doctor to discuss your kidney health. WebThe damage can occur gradually over time, resulting in chronic kidney disease, or suddenly, causing acute kidney injury. In many cases, the damage to the kidneys can be reversed, and the organ can be repaired, but it depends on the level of damage, the underlying cause, and timely diagnoses.
